I'm not sure about the specific medthod of changing the flag in
localconf.php, but it seems like areal pain, and I'm inclined to think
it/ might/ leave your typo3 install open to abuse. That's a totally
uneducated opinion so please take with a grain of salt. ;)
There should be a way to set a site exception for "michael-baker.com"
in Zone Alarm's web filter.
I have been using Kerio firewall and I personally like it better than ZA
(though I never used ZAP.) when I first installed it I had the exact
same problem Typo, but the problem was fixed quickly & easily in the
program configuration.

Michael Baker wrote:
>I recently upgraded ZoneAlarmPro to version 6.0.667.000.
>Since doing so I was unable to login to my typo3 back end. I kept getting:
>
>Error: This host address ("michael-baker.com") and the referer host ("")
>mismatches!
>It's possible that the environment variable HTTP_REFERER is not passed
>to the script because of a proxy.
>The site administrator can disable this check in the configuration
>(flag: TYPO3_CONF_VARS[SYS][doNotCheckReferer]).
>
>I am my administrator and I could not disable this check until I loged
>in :-( .
>
>Fortunately I found that when I unchecked "Enable Privacy for this
>program" for my webbrowser in the ZoneAlarmPro Control Center, the
>problem went away. :-)
>This is available in the ZAP Control Center from Program Control |
>Firefox | Options | Filter Options
>
>Then when I logged in to the BE I used Install to add the suggested flag
>to localconf.php. Now I am able to login with Enable Privacy for Firefox
>enabled again.
>
>Does any one have suggestions as to the pros and cons of either of these
>methods.
